Question

What is the primary function of northbound APIs in a SDN environment?

Options

  • Acommunication between the data plane and the control plane
  • Bsecure data communication across the network
  • Ccommunication within network devices
  • Dcommunication between the SDN controller and the application plane

Explanation

Northbound APIs allow applications to communicate with the SDN controller, enabling the controller to expose network abstractions and provide programmability to upper-layer
